Just an interesting note… if you were to increase your annual salary by $4K, it would increase your hourly wage by $1.92 per hour. WebJan 3, 2024 · Semi-monthly wage = (Monthly wage)/2. Using yearly wage: There are 24 semi-monthly pay periods during a year. Therefore, we can calculate the semi-monthly pay by dividing the annual salary by 24: Semi-monthly wage = (Yearly wage)/24. Is the Salary Always Yearly? No, salary does not have to be an annual figure, since some pay periods may be weekly, biweekly, monthly, or semi monthly, which may simply alter the annual figure slightly from year to year if one year consists of an extra pay period due to calendar variances.
